<?php
declare(strict_types=1);
use PhpCsFixer\Config;
use PhpCsFixer\Finder;
use PhpCsFixer\Runner\Parallel\ParallelConfig;
$header = <<<'EOF'
This file is part of Sqlcommenter Hyperf.
Sqlcommenter Hyperf provides an implementation of Sqlcommenter for the Hyperf framework,
allowing you to automatically add comments to your SQL queries to provide better insights
and traceability in your application's database interactions.
@link https://github.com/reinanhs/sqlcommenter-hyperf
@document https://github.com/reinanhs/sqlcommenter-hyperf/wiki
@license https://github.com/reinanhs/sqlcommenter-hyperf/blob/main/LICENSE
EOF;
$maxProcesses = function_exists('swoole_cpu_num') ? swoole_cpu_num() : 4;
return (new Config())
->setParallelConfig(new ParallelConfig($maxProcesses, 20))
->setRiskyAllowed(true)
->setRules([
'@PSR2' => true,
'@Symfony' => true,
'@DoctrineAnnotation' => true,
'@PhpCsFixer' => true,
'header_comment' => [
'comment_type' => 'PHPDoc',
'header' => $header,
'separate' => 'none',
'location' => 'after_declare_strict',
],
'array_syntax' => [
'syntax' => 'short',
],
'list_syntax' => [
'syntax' => 'short',
],
'concat_space' => [
'spacing' => 'one',
],
'blank_line_before_statement' => [
'statements' => [
'declare',
],
],
'general_phpdoc_annotation_remove' => [
'annotations' => [
'author',
],
],
'ordered_imports' => [
'imports_order' => [
'class', 'function', 'const',
],
'sort_algorithm' => 'alpha',
],
'single_line_comment_style' => [
'comment_types' => [
],
],
'yoda_style' => [
'always_move_variable' => false,
'equal' => false,
'identical' => false,
],
'phpdoc_align' => [
'align' => 'left',
],
'multiline_whitespace_before_semicolons' => [
'strategy' => 'no_multi_line',
],
'constant_case' => [
'case' => 'lower',
],
'global_namespace_import' => [
'import_classes' => true,
'import_constants' => true,
'import_functions' => true,
],
'class_attributes_separation' => true,
'combine_consecutive_unsets' => true,
'declare_strict_types' => true,
'linebreak_after_opening_tag' => true,
'lowercase_static_reference' => true,
'no_useless_else' => true,
'no_unused_imports' => true,
'not_operator_with_successor_space' => true,
'not_operator_with_space' => false,
'ordered_class_elements' => true,
'php_unit_strict' => false,
'phpdoc_separation' => false,
'single_quote' => true,
'standardize_not_equals' => true,
'multiline_comment_opening_closing' => true,
// Since PHP 8.3, default null values can be declared as nullable.
'nullable_type_declaration_for_default_null_value' => true,
'single_line_empty_body' => false,
])
->setFinder(
Finder::create()
->exclude('.cache')
->exclude('.docker')
->exclude('.phpunit.cache')
->exclude('tools')
->exclude('vendor')
->in(__DIR__)
)
->setUsingCache(false);
